American Express Officially Introduces Gift Card Commemorating Chinese New Year

American Express Co. Jan. 13 officially released a gift card to commemorate the Chinese New Year, which begins Feb. 14. AmEx originally announced the card in October when it eliminated monthly fees on all its gift cards (see story).

The limited-edition Auspicious Year of the Tiger Gift Card is available online for $3.95 with free shipping. It features a golden roaring tiger against a red background and is available in denominations of US$25, US$50, US$100 and US$200. The card is targeted at the Chinese-American community, American Express says in a statement.

A special $88-denomination card is available in select retail locations, American Express confirmed to PaymentsSource. In Chinese culture, the number 88 represents good luck.
